Mock Exams

Mock exams are your secret weapon for exam readiness. Treat these exams as the real deal: adhere strictly to the time limit and exam conditions. After each mock exam, thoroughly review your performance. Identify areas where you struggled and revisit the relevant concepts. Pay attention to the mark scheme to understand how marks are awarded and where you can gain easy points. This process helps you refine your exam technique and build confidence.

  2. Past Paper Power: Analysis and Strategy

    Now for the fun part! Time to unleash the power of past papers. Start by collecting as many past year papers as you can get your hands on. Ideally, you want to cover at least the last 5 years, if not more. The more, the merrier, hor?

    • Spotting Common Question Patterns and Difficulty Levels: Don't just blindly solve the papers. Analyze them! What topics consistently appear? Are there specific types of questions that are frequently tested? Are there certain questions that are more difficult than others? Identify the common question patterns and difficulty levels and focus your efforts accordingly.
    • Techniques for Efficient Time Management: Time is of the essence during the exam. Practice time management techniques while solving past papers. Allocate a specific amount of time for each question and stick to it. If you're stuck on a question, don't waste too much time on it. Move on and come back to it later if you have time.
  3. Simulate Exam Conditions

    Don't just practice in your pajamas on your bed! Create a realistic exam environment. Find a quiet place, set a timer, and avoid distractions. This will help you get used to the pressure of the actual exam and improve your performance under stress.

  4. Detailed Answer Analysis

    The real learning happens *after* you've attempted the paper. Don't just check your answers and move on. Go through each question in detail, even the ones you got right. Understand the marking scheme and identify areas where you lost marks. Learn from your mistakes and make sure you don't repeat them in the future.
